How to use this skill
Workflow
- Create a connection - New Connection > Select database type > Configure host/port/credentials > Test Connection
- Write SQL - Open SQL Editor (F3) > Write query > Execute (Ctrl+Enter)
- Manage data - Right-click table > Export Data or Import Data > Choose format
- Generate ER diagram - Right-click schema > View Diagram > Arrange tables
Quick-Start Example: Connect and Query
1. File > New > Database Connection
2. Select "PostgreSQL" > Enter:
Host: localhost
Port: 5432
Database: mydb
Username: admin
Password: ****
3. Click "Test Connection" to verify
4. Open SQL Editor (F3), run:
SELECT table_name, pg_size_pretty(pg_total_relation_size(table_name::text))
FROM information_schema.tables
WHERE table_schema = 'public'
ORDER BY pg_total_relation_size(table_name::text) DESC;
Data Export
Right-click table > Export Data >
Format: CSV / JSON / SQL INSERT / Excel
Options: Set delimiter, encoding, header row
Target: File or clipboard
Best Practices
- Driver management - DBeaver auto-downloads drivers on first connect; update drivers periodically
- Secure credentials - Enable encrypted password storage in connection properties
- Transaction mode - Switch to manual commit in production to prevent accidental changes
- Result set navigation - Use filters, sorting, and pagination for large result sets
- Keyboard shortcuts - Ctrl+Enter to execute, Ctrl+Shift+E to explain plan, F3 for SQL editor
